vty: add "msc N bssmap reset" command
Allow resetting the BSSMAP link from VTY, for BSC_Tests.ttcn. In the field, detecting that an MSC is lost is done by getting three connection failures in a row. For the BSC_Tests, it is easier to just provide a VTY command to reset an MSC's link status. I want to add tests that verify the stat items reflecting the MSC connection status. To be able to run a test expecting fewer connected MSC after a test that launched more MSCs requires the links to be reset.
